Origin & History

Derived directly from the English word 'river', this name's origin is distinctly descriptive and natural. While once uncommon as a given name, its use began to rise in the late 20th century, particularly within cultures embracing nature-inspired and gender-neutral naming conventions. Its simplicity and evocative power quickly made it a beloved choice, symbolizing a direct connection to the vital forces of the planet and an appreciation for ecological beauty.

FAQ

Is River a masculine or feminine name?

River is predominantly a unisex name, growing in popularity for both boys and girls. Its natural imagery transcends traditional gender boundaries.

What does the name River symbolize?

The name River symbolizes continuous flow, adaptability, life's journey, renewal, and deep connection to nature. It represents growth and resilience.

Are there any famous people named River?

Yes, a notable figure is the late actor River Phoenix. The name also appears in various fictional works and has been chosen by celebrities for their children.
